Introduction to Opus Plasma Treatment
Opus Plasma is a cutting-edge aesthetic treatment that combines the power of plasma and radiofrequency to rejuvenate the skin. This non-invasive procedure is designed to address various skin concerns, including wrinkles, scars, and uneven skin texture. Patients in Waterford are increasingly opting for this treatment due to its effectiveness and minimal downtime. Initial Discomfort Post-Treatment
Immediately following the Opus Plasma treatment, patients may experience a sensation similar to a mild sunburn. This discomfort is typically short-lived, lasting anywhere from a few hours to a day. The skin may feel warm and tight, and some redness is normal. Applying a cold compress or using soothing skincare products can help alleviate this initial discomfort.
Peak Pain Duration
The peak of the pain usually occurs within the first 24 to 48 hours after the treatment. During this period, patients might feel a stinging or tingling sensation. This is a natural part of the healing process as the skin begins to regenerate. Over-the-counter pain relievers can be used to manage this discomfort, but it is advisable to consult with the treating physician for specific recommendations.
Gradual Pain Reduction
After the initial 48 hours, the pain begins to subside gradually. By the end of the first week, most patients report a significant reduction in discomfort. The skin continues to heal, and the sensation of pain is replaced by mild itching, which is a sign of new skin growth. It is crucial to avoid scratching or picking at the treated area to prevent infection and ensure optimal healing.
Full Recovery and Pain Resolution
By the second week post-treatment, the pain should be completely resolved for most patients. The skin will have healed sufficiently, and any remaining redness or swelling will have diminished. At this stage, patients can resume their normal skincare routine and daily activities. However, it is recommended to continue using gentle products and avoid harsh exfoliants or aggressive treatments for a few more weeks to ensure complete recovery.
Factors Influencing Pain Duration
Several factors can influence the duration and intensity of pain following Opus Plasma treatment. These include the individual's pain tolerance, the extent of the treatment area, and the expertise of the practitioner. Patients with a higher pain tolerance may experience less discomfort and recover more quickly. Additionally, larger treatment areas may result in more prolonged pain due to the increased skin trauma. Lastly, the skill and experience of the practitioner play a significant role in minimizing pain and ensuring a smooth recovery process.
FAQ
Q: How long does the redness last after Opus Plasma treatment?
A: Redness is a common side effect and typically lasts for about 3-5 days. It may persist for up to a week in some cases.
Q: Can I use makeup after the treatment?
A: It is generally recommended to avoid makeup for at least 24 hours post-treatment to allow the skin to heal. After this period, you can resume using makeup, but ensure it is non-comedogenic and gentle.
Q: When can I resume my regular skincare routine?
A: You can start incorporating your regular skincare products after about a week, but avoid any harsh or exfoliating products for at least two weeks.
Q: Is the pain severe enough to require medication?
A: The pain is usually mild to moderate and can be managed with over-the-counter pain relievers. However, if you experience severe pain, consult your physician.
Q: How often can I undergo Opus Plasma treatment?
A: Typically, treatments are spaced 4-6 weeks apart to allow the skin to fully recover and achieve optimal results.
